Вопрос задан 23.03.2021 в 15:39. Предмет Информатика. Спрашивает Гекк Влад.

2. Напечатать текст, удалив из него все цифры. Текст заканчивается точкой.

0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Борисович Станислав.
Var s1,s2:string;
i:integer;
begin
writeln('Введите текст:');
readln(s1);
s2:='';
for i:=1 to length(s1) do
 if (s1[i]<'0')or(s1[i]>'9') then s2:=s2+s1[i];
writeln(s2);
end.

Пример:
Введите текст:
В два ряда дома стоят – 10, 20, 100 подряд.
В два ряда дома стоят – , ,  подряд.
0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Хорошо, вот пример кода на Python, который позволит вам удалить все цифры из текста:

python
text = "Ваш текст с цифрами 1234, который нужно обработать." text_without_digits = ''.join(filter(lambda x: not x.isdigit(), text)) print(text_without_digits)

Результатом выполнения этого кода будет:

Ваш текст с цифрами , который нужно обработать.

Таким образом, все цифры в тексте будут удалены, а остальные символы останутся без изменений.

0 0

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ос